PostPosted: Mon Apr 11, 2005 9:42 am    Post subject: 61 Mango is home Reply with quote

I've been working on this deal for 3 months. Finally towed it home on Saturday. Made it without incident and the bus is now safely stored in my garage. Plans are for a mechanical restoration/body preservation. Sportin' OG paint, OG motor, OG interior and lots of patina! Bus was originally from Mass and has a 1965 registration sticker on the pass. front window.

PostPosted: Tue Apr 12, 2005 10:36 am    Post subject: Reply with quote

I started doing some cleaning last night. I vacuumed out under the front seat. There sure is a lot of space to stash stuff under the front bench. This is my first bus that isn't a walk-thru so I'm not used to the front bench set-up.
I found a 1969 quarter and a 1972 dime way down below the where the spare tire sits. I also opened up the overhead fresh air distribution box and found this:
Image may have been reduced in size. Click image to view fullscreen.

NASTY! Looks like is was rodent nest for years and was still in use pretty recently too. Fortunatey I haven't found any live or dead critters yet.
